My wife needs a new phone, and we are both at a loss for the best phone for
her needs. She needs a good phone for fringe reception in the boondocks,
and she wants internet access for checking Webmail. GPS would be nice, but
not a deal-breaker.
Her old RAzR has just about croaked, and I got her a BlackBerry Curve for
Christmas. However, she says the BlackBerry's keypad is too small and hard
to read/use.
We tried an Instinct at the Sprint store, and she liked it better as far as
being able to dial and surf, but the interface with all the other options
was confusing. Also, I don't want to get buried with a data everything plan
that costs us out the wazoo every month.
Any ideas for us? The more we look and the more we read, the more we
realize we are getting confused.

So far the BEST phones I have seen for fringe receptions are the SANYOs...
Have you looked at the new Sanyo ECLIPSE X?
It has GPS, but I am not sure it is 'open' like other phones are where
something like Google Maps can use it.
My son has the Eclipse X. When I picked it up to use, the menus did not seem
as intuitive as other Sanyo's...
We are running that phone on and old, old grandfathered plan with the old
unlimited Vision.. |
